DNS Changer allows you to change DNS servers to get better Internet connection for both Wi-Fi and Mobile data networks without root requirement.
As you known, Internet Service Providers or ISPs provide you a default DNS server, but you should consider to use another DNS server because it can:
• Help you get better Internet access speed
• Help you prevent apps from displaying ads by using a DNS that can block ads
• Help you access the region-blocked websites
• Ensure that your ISP is not able to collect your Internet browsing history
• Help protect you against security attacks such as phishing, malware, and ransomware

Please note that:
• This app only sets up a local VPN interface to be able to change DNS server addresses without root. And it does not request the dangerous permissions such as Location, Contacts, SMS, Storage,... So, you can trust that it does not connect to a remote server to steal your privacy data. Please feel safe to use!
• Because this app is based on VPN framework, so you cannot use another VPN at the same time.

• Why can't I press "OK" button of the dialog?
This problem may be caused by using an app that can overlay other apps, such as blue light filter apps. Those apps may overlay the VPN dialog, so that cannot press "OK" button. This is a bug of Android OS which needs to be fixed by Google via an OS update. So if your device hasn't fixed yet, you may need to turn off the light filter apps and try again.
